Roma's Daniele De Rossi out 'about 4 weeks' with calf strain
Stefano Rellandini / Reuters
If only Daniele De Rossi's calves were as strong as his loyalty to AS Roma.
On Friday, Roma announced that De Rossi will be out for "about four weeks" due to a calf strain, as the Italian midfielder suffered a Grade-1 lesion to the soleus muscle in his left leg.
De Rossi, 32, has tallied one goal and one assist while starting in 18 of Roma's Serie A fixtures this season. He also ranks 10th in the league in pass success percentage at 88.4 percent.
